Mitochondrial Function

Mitochondrial function encompasses oxidative phosphorylation, biogenesis (driven by PGC-1α), and quality-control processes (mitophagy). The mitochondrial-derived peptide MOTS-c regulates AMPK signaling and metabolic homeostasis. NAD+ supports the electron-transport chain and mitochondrial sirtuins (SIRT3, SIRT4, SIRT5).
